πŸ“œ A Brief History of Homemade Bread

Bread is one of the oldest prepared foods in human history, dating back more than 10,000 years. Ancient civilizations discovered that mixing ground grains with water and allowing the mixture to ferment created a lighter, more flavorful loaf. Today, homemade bread remains a cherished tradition around the world, bringing families together through the simple joy of baking.


πŸ₯– Foolproof Homemade Bread Recipe

πŸ›’ Ingredients

  • 4 cups (500g) all-purpose or bread flour
  • 1Β½ cups (360ml) warm water (110Β°F/43Β°C)
  • 2ΒΌ teaspoons (1 packet) active dry yeast
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 1Β½ teaspoons salt
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il or melted butter

Optional Toppings

  • Melted butter for brushing
  • Sesame seeds
  • Poppy seeds
  • Oats

πŸ₯£ Instructions

Step 1: Activate the Yeast

  1. Pour warm water into a large mixing bowl.
  2. Add sugar and yeast.
  3. Stir gently and let sit for 5–10 minutes until foamy.

Step 2: Make the Dough

  1. Add olive oil and salt.
  2. Gradually mix in the flour, one cup at a time.
  3. Stir until a shaggy dough forms.

Step 3: Knead

  1. Transfer dough to a lightly floured surface.
  2. Knead for 8–10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
  3. Add small amounts of flour if the dough feels too sticky.

Step 4: First Rise

  1. Place dough in a lightly oiled bowl.
  2. Cover with a clean towel.
  3. Let rise in a warm place for 1 hour or until doubled in size.

Step 5: Shape the Loaf

  1. Punch down the dough gently.
  2. Shape into a loaf.
  3. Place into a greased 9Γ—5-inch loaf pan.

Step 6: Second Rise

  1. Cover loosely.
  2. Allow to rise for 30–40 minutes until puffy.

Step 7: Bake

  1. Preheat oven to 375Β°F (190Β°C).
  2. Bake for 30–35 minutes until golden brown.
  3. Bread should sound hollow when tapped on the bottom.

Step 8: Finish

  1. Remove from oven.
  2. Brush the top with melted butter for a soft, shiny crust.
  3. Cool for at least 15 minutes before slicing.

🍞 Baking Methods

Traditional Method

Knead by hand for the best texture and classic artisan feel.

Stand Mixer Method

Use a dough hook and knead for 5–6 minutes on medium speed.

Dutch Oven Method

Bake in a preheated Dutch oven for a crisp, rustic crust.

Bread Machine Method

Add ingredients according to your machine’s instructions and use the basic white bread setting.
